it is very important to have an endorsement with CAL. As for doing your own type rating, some of the ex ansett guys had to go to seattelt to do an endorsement, and I believe their pay will be reduced as CAL paid for the endorsement but I am not exactly sure.

Do not get a rating on your own. If anything speak to CAL and tell them of your interest.

Oncce and for all. CAL is looking for guys BUT you must be type rated. A very few guys have got through the door without a rating BUT it is not the norm. You still can try though no harm.
